When Repeat Open-Heart Surgery Was Too Risky, an Advanced Minimally Invasive Procedure Brought Hope Back
A 68-year-old woman had already overcome one major health battle when she underwent mitral valve replacement surgery in 2015 for severe rheumatic mitral stenosis. The artificial valve served her well for nearly a decade, allowing her to lead a better quality of life.
However, over time, the bioprosthetic valve gradually degenerated. She began experiencing severe breathlessness, which slowly progressed to advanced heart failure. Fluid accumulated throughout her body, her urine output reduced significantly, and she developed CO₂ narcosis, making BiPAP support necessary even at home. Her condition became more critical with atrial fibrillation, bilateral pleural effusion, pneumonitis, and a urinary tract infection.
With multiple life-threatening complications and an extremely high surgical risk, repeat open-heart surgery was no longer considered the safest option.
When she arrived at Wockhardt Hospital, Nagpur, the Structural Heart Team led by Dr. Nitin Tiwari, Senior Interventional Cardiologist, carefully evaluated her condition and decided to offer her another chance through one of the most advanced heart procedures available today.
Dr. Tiwari successfully performed a Transcatheter Mitral Valve Replacement (TMVR) using the Valve-in-Valve technique with a 23 mm Myval Transcatheter Heart Valve (THV).
TMVR is an advanced minimally invasive procedure in which a new heart valve is delivered through a blood vessel or a small incision without opening the chest. In this case, the new valve was implanted inside the patient’s failing artificial valve, restoring normal blood flow while avoiding the risks of repeat open-heart surgery. The procedure offers faster recovery and significantly less surgical trauma.
The procedure was technically successful, but recovery required equally intensive care. Following the intervention, the patient required ventilator support, intermittent non-invasive ventilation, aggressive heart failure management, intravenous antibiotics, drainage of pleural fluid, nutritional support, and continuous monitoring by the multidisciplinary team.
There were difficult days when progress was slow, but gradually she improved. She was weaned off the ventilator, her breathing became easier, oxygen levels stabilized, and the newly implanted valve functioned well. Day by day, she regained her strength. Eventually, she was discharged from the hospital with a stable heart, improved quality of life, and renewed hope.
